Eqt (EQT) Interest Expenses (2016 - 2026)

Eqt has reported Interest Expenses over the past 18 years, most recently at $96.8 million for Q1 2026.

  • Quarterly Interest Expenses fell 17.68% to $96.8 million in Q1 2026 from the year-ago period, while the trailing twelve-month figure was $417.9 million through Mar 2026, down 19.33% year-over-year, with the annual reading at $438.7 million for FY2025, 3.55% down from the prior year.
  • Interest Expenses was $96.8 million for Q1 2026 at Eqt, down from $105.5 million in the prior quarter.
  • Over five years, Interest Expenses peaked at $186.4 million in Q4 2024 and troughed at $39.9 million in Q2 2023.
  • The 5-year median for Interest Expenses is $67.9 million (2022), against an average of $85.9 million.
  • Biggest five-year swings in Interest Expenses: soared 161.97% in 2024 and later crashed 43.4% in 2025.
  • Tracing EQT's Interest Expenses over 5 years: stood at $55.6 million in 2022, then soared by 30.87% to $72.8 million in 2023, then soared by 156.08% to $186.4 million in 2024, then crashed by 43.4% to $105.5 million in 2025, then decreased by 8.29% to $96.8 million in 2026.
  • According to Business Quant data, Interest Expenses over the past three periods came in at $96.8 million, $105.5 million, and $109.9 million for Q1 2026, Q4 2025, and Q3 2025 respectively.
